Consultation underway on A26 Dualling

ROADS Minister Danny Kennedy visited Ballymena last Wednesday to view the public exhibition of Roads Service proposals for the dualling of an eight kilometre stretch of the A26 Ballymena to Ballymoney road at Glarryford.

The two-day exhibition, staged at the Tullyglass Hotel, was part of a process of public consultation which continues until May 11.

Representatives from Roads Service, along with engineering and environmental consultants, were available at the exhibition to explain more about the scheme.

Danny Kennedy commented: “This is a strategically important road scheme and a new dual carriageway would improve road safety and reduce journey times.”
